About

Seven-time All-Star and five-time Gold Glove winner at second base also known for his clutch-hitting.

Before Fame

He debuted for the New York Yankees in 1955 at the age of 19.

Trivia

He hit .367 with 12 RBIs in the 1960 World Series and was chosen as the series MVP, the first time the award was given to a member of the losing team.

Family Life

He was born the second child of Robert Clinton, Sr. and Willie Richardson.

Associated With

Joe DiMaggio supported his unsuccessful 1976 bid for Congress.
